Watami Meguru pleaded to his mom to let him move out on his own to experience being independent. She finally agrees to let Meguru rent out a room for the summer. But his sadistic mother makes the wall between him and his neighbor out of glass, meaning there is no privacy between the two rooms. If living openly with a stranger wasn’t insane enough, his neighbor is a cute girl his age, Kana. They immediately get off on the wrong foot and this isn’t what Meguru imagined it would be like at all.

Yohei is in the Woodwinds Orchestra at his high school where he plays the clarinet as one of the few boys in the group. The president of the group is Azumi who also happens to be Yohei's first girlfriend. Azumi has never had a boyfriend before, and the couple has many awkward moments as their relationship is still fresh. With both Yohei and Azumi acting a little shy with each other, being intimate is difficult but their love for each other makes them braver.

NEETs are people who have chosen not to be part of society due to personal problems or just straight-out laziness. This story is centered around a certain young woman who has become a NEET right after high school without even realizing it. In her case, though, it's not that she doesn't want work - but rather that there is not a single job out there which can fulfill her very specific criteria... Oh, well...at least her mother understands her! *Note: Includes two extra chapters.*
